Three Lanarkshire carers have been given training by a leading care specialist in a new project aimed at encouraging more young people to consider a career in care.Nickelle Murray, from Bellshill, Erin Lang, from Motherwell and Lauren McCombe, from Moodiesburn were part of a group of five Scots chosen by the Prince's Trust as part of a new project with HRM Homecare, one of Scotland’s leading care at home specialists.The care provider joined forces with the youth charity to encourage more youngsters to consider a long-term career in the industry.The Lanarkshire Live app is available to download now.
